|
|||||||||
软件包 java.util.jar
提供读写 JAR (Java ARchive) 文件格式的类,该格式基于具有可选清单文件的标准 ZIP 文件格式。请参见:
描述
接口摘要 | |
---|---|
Pack200.Packer | 打包器引擎把各种转换应用到输入 JAR 文件,从而可以通过压缩器(如 gzip 或 zip)高度压缩打包流。 |
Pack200.Unpacker | 解包器引擎将打包的流转换为 JAR 文件。 |
类摘要 | |
---|---|
Attributes | Attributes 类将 Manifest 属性名称映射到关联的字符串值。 |
Attributes.Name | Attributes.Name 类表示存储在此 Map 中的一个属性名称。 |
JarEntry | 此类用于表示 JAR 文件条目。 |
JarFile | JarFile 类用于从任何可以使用 java.io.RandomAccessFile 打开的文件中读取 jar 文件的内容。 |
JarInputStream | JarInputStream 类用于从任何输入流读取 JAR 文件内容。 |
JarOutputStream | JarOutputStream 类用于向任何输出流写入 JAR 文件内容。 |
Manifest | Manifest 类用于维护 Manifest 条目名称及其相关的 Attributes。 |
Pack200 | 以 Pack200 格式在 JAR 文件和打包的流之间进行转换。 |
异常摘要 | |
---|---|
JarException | 读取或写入 JAR 文件时,如果发生某种错误,则抛出此异常。 |
软件包 java.util.jar 的描述
提供读写 JAR (Java ARchive) 文件格式的类,该格式基于具有可选清单文件的标准 ZIP 文件格式。清单存储与 JAR 文件内容有关的元信息,也用于签名 JAR 文件。
包规范
java.util.zip
包基于以下规范:
- Info-ZIP 文件格式 - 基于 Info-ZIP 文件格式的 JAR 格式。参见 java.util.zip 包规范。
在 JAR 文件中,所有文件名必须以 UTF-8 编码进行编码。
- 《Manifest and Signature Specification》 - 清单格式规范。
- 从以下版本开始:
- 1.2
所有类
|
|||||||||